Taylor Farms expands lettuce recall to 27 states

Summary

Taylor Farms has increased its recall of iceberg lettuce to include 27 states. The recall is due to a parasite found in lettuce from a supplier in central Mexico, which caused a severe diarrhea outbreak.

Key Facts

  • Taylor Farms issued a voluntary recall of iceberg lettuce.
  • The recalled lettuce was sent to 27 U.S. states.
  • The source of the lettuce is a supplier located in central Mexico.
  • Federal health officials linked the lettuce to the spread of a parasite.
  • The parasite causes severe diarrhea.
  • The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) helped identify the contaminated lettuce.
  • The recall includes shredded iceberg lettuce specifically.
